字符类型

2019-01-14

字符类型


字符有两种不同的表示法:: ANSIChar 和 WideChar。第一种类型代表 8 位的字符,与 Windows 一直沿用的 ANSI(美国国家标准协会)字符集相应;第二种类型代表 16 位的字符,与 Windows NT、Windows 95 和 98 支持的双字节字符(Unicode)相应。在 Delphi 3 中,Char 类型字符与 ANSIChar 一致。切记,不管在什么环境,前 256 个Unicode 字符与 ANSI 字符是完全一致的。

常量字符可用代表它们的符号表示,如‘k’,也可用数字符号表示,如 #78。后者还可用 Chr 函数表示为 Chr(78),用 Ord 函数可作相反的转换 Ord (k)。

一般来说,对字母、数字或符号,用代表它们的符号来表示较好;而涉及到特殊字符时用数字符号较好。下面列出了常用的特殊字符:

  • #9 跳格 (Tab 键)

  • #10 换行

  • #13 回车 (Enter 键)


阅读64